Spanish

Etymology

From a- +‎ balanza (balance) +‎ -ar, from Latin bilanx, bilancēs.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): (Spain) /abalanˈθaɾ/ [a.β̞a.lãn̟ˈθaɾ]
  • IPA(key): (Latin America, Philippines) /abalanˈsaɾ/ [a.β̞a.lãnˈsaɾ]

Verb

Lua error in Module:parameters at line 797: Parameter 2 is not used by this template.

  1. (transitive) to propel
  2. (transitive, dated) to balance, compensate
  3. (reflexive, abalanzarse sobre) to pounce on, swoop down on
